Meeting Rooms

Community groups whose purpose are non-profit, civic, cultural or educational may schedule meetings when the rooms are not being used for library related activities.

No admission, attendance charge, or required donation may be assessed by any non-Library group using a meeting room. Meeting rooms may not be used for social activities, private parties, commercial endeavors, or those which advertise a product or service.

By submitting your request, you acknowledge that you have read and agree to abide by the Lane Public Library System’s Meeting Room Policy.

A request does not secure the meeting room space. You will be contacted by a Lane Libraries staff member 24 – 48 hours after the request submission and will be formally notified as to whether or not the booking can be accommodated. For bookings requested with less than 48 hours notice, please call the library location directly and speak with a staff person. Requests are subject to meeting room availability and library programs take precedence.
